Not Linux but I've used both those engines briefly.
I tried using Cocos2d and the SDK / IDE installer was broken as fuck. Then after finally getting it working I found that there weren't many guides because the switch to JS was relatively recent. So I never got a chance to really try it.
Unity is easy as fuck. I used that back in highschool to start making a 2.5D beat em up. Never finished but what I did make was really easy.

I've heard about it but how good is godot, really?
>>53539390
Its great, but the documentation is a bit spare and the 3D part of the engine is atm not so capable as unity.
I use it a few month now and it gets frequent updates so the 3D part should get better in time.
